1. Overview of Ontario’s Online Gaming Landscape
Ontario has emerged as a prominent player in the online gaming sector, driven by its regulatory framework and a growing population interested in digital entertainment. The Alcohol and Gaming Commission of Ontario (AGCO) governs online casinos, ensuring fair play, consumer protection, and responsible gambling practices. JackpotCity Casino, as one of the leading online gaming platforms, operates under these regulations, which are designed to create a safe environment for players. The province launched its regulated market in April 2021, allowing private operators to enter under licensing agreements. This step has significantly transformed the competitive landscape and elevated consumer trust.
2. Key Global Regulations Influencing JackpotCity
As an international online casino, JackpotCity is subject to various regulations depending on the jurisdictions in which it operates. Here are some key regulations that influence their operations:
- Licensing and Registration: Online casinos must acquire licenses from regulatory bodies in different jurisdictions. In Ontario, this means adhering to AGCO’s standards.
- AML and KYC Compliance: Anti-Money Laundering (AML) and Know Your Customer (KYC) regulations are enforced to prevent fraud and illicit activities.
- Player Protection Regulations: These laws ensure that players have access to safe gambling environments, which include responsible gambling programs that aim to minimize addiction risks.
- Data Protection Laws: Casinos must comply with regulations like the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) to protect user data and privacy.
- Advertising Standards: Strict guidelines surround how online casinos can market themselves, with a focus on ensuring that promotions are not misleading.
